Description
Immaculately presented to a very high standard, Ashwood is a brand-new home finished in 2024. It’s the ideal family home, with ample space over three floors and a great setting in an area that’s popular with families, with great road links and close proximity to schools and nurseries. The house has been built to an exacting specification by Welby Homes, with beautifully appointed interiors throughout and premium fixtures such as cat 6 cabling, low voltage LED lighting, porcelain tiling to the ground floor and the bath and shower rooms.
A highlight is the open plan living space on the ground floor, which enjoys excellent natural light due to its use of glazing. The room incorporates dining and family areas as well as the fabulous kitchen, which is fitted with a wine fridge, Bora induction hob and a range of Siemens integrated appliances. The floor-to-ceiling glazed doors can be opened to the garden, allowing a generous space for entertaining. There is also a separate sitting room with an inset for a fireplace; a cloakroom area; and a WC. Upstairs there is a principal bedroom with dressing room and en suite shower room, two further bedrooms and a family bathroom on the first floor, and two further bedrooms and a shower room on the second floor. All of the bedrooms benefit from built-in storage.
Outside
Ashwood is situated just off the popular Wycombe Road, with access to local footpaths at the end of Gypsy Lane. The house has a shared entrance with its attached neighbour, with ample off-street parking on the generous resin bound driveway. With its oak-framed porch, partially tile-hung elevations complete with date stone and attractive landscaping, this house has an upscale appearance that sets it apart from its neighbours, though blends well with the Edwardian homes in the area.
The west-facing rear garden is enclosed by wooden panel fencing and there is a courtyard area to the side, with access from the front via a side gate; a generous paved terrace accessed from the living area by glazed doors; and a good-size lawn with great potential for further landscaping.
Location
Marlow is a popular location for young families, with numerous schooling options ranging from prep schools to secondary schools including Sir William Borlase’s Grammar School. Marlow town offers a superb range of retailers, with an eclectic mix of local independent and national names. There are bars, cafes and restaurants dotted around the town offering destinations for any occasion. Just outside Marlow, the area opens out to glorious rolling countryside and a designated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ty.
Outdoor pursuits are plentiful, as are golf, football, cricket and rugby clubs. For commuters, Marlow has a train station (one mile) to Paddington (via Maidenhead) and the M40/M4 motorways are accessed from the A404(M) which passes east of the town.
